Report most sales and other capital transactions and calculate capital gain or loss on Form 8949, Sales and Other Dispositions of Capital … WebCGT on disposals between 1 January and 30 November must be paid by 15 December of the same year. Tax on disposals made between 1 December and 31 December must be paid by 31 January of the following year. Payment of CGT can be made using the Revenue Online Service. The CGT return deadlineis 31 October of the year following disposal.

WebFeb 22, 2024 · An elderly client needs to declare their property capital gains tax within 30 days. In order to authorise us as their agent on the capital gains tax portal, the client needs to create their own online service account. Not only is the client unable to do this themselves, but they can't pass the online verification process. WebJul 8, 2024 · You can start a new return from your client’s Capital Gains Tax on UK property ‘account home’. The return will be saved in your client’s account for 30 days from the … blank graphing chartWebJul 12, 2024 · Yes, a separate digital authorisation known as a ‘digital handshake’ needs to take place before you will be able to file your client’s UK Property Disposal return online. Your client needs to create their UK Property Disposal account online first then give their Capital Gains Tax account reference number to you, as their agent. blank graphing sheetWebA: You will need to report the disposal and pay any CGT due within 60 days of the completion of the disposal. Reporting and payment will be made electronically. Customers will report using the new online CGT Payment on Property Disposal system.
